The octagon returns to St. Louis for the primary time since January 2018 on Saturday with UFC on ESPN 56, which works down at Enterprise Middle and encompasses a 13-bout lineup headlined by heavyweights.

All-time UFC knockout document holder Derrick Lewis (27-12 MMA, 18-10 UFC) will get one other important occasion task. “The Black Beast” takes on the unheralded Rodrigo Nascimento (11-1 MMA, 4-1 UFC) in a five-round struggle that may push the winner into an upward trajectory.

Derrick Lewis vs. Rodrigo Nascimento

Derrick Lewis

Derrick Lewis

Lewis competes in his twenty ninth UFC heavyweight bout, the second-most appearances in divisional historical past behind Andrei Arlovski (41).

Lewis is 1-4 in his previous 5 fights courting again to February 2022.

Lewis’ 18 victories in UFC heavyweight competitors are second-most in divisional historical past behind Arlovski (23).

Lewis’ 14 stoppage victories in UFC heavyweight competitors are most in divisional historical past.

Lewis’ 14 stoppage victories in UFC competitors are tied for sixth-most in firm historical past behind Charles Oliveira (20), Jim Miller (17), Donald Cerrone (16), Matt Brown (15) and Dustin Poirier (15).

Lewis’ 14 knockout victories in UFC competitors are most in firm historical past.

Lewis’ 14 knockout victories in UFC competitors stemming from punches are probably the most in firm historical past.

Lewis’ eight knockouts stemming from floor strikes in UFC competitors are tied with Cain Velasquez for many in firm historical past.

Lewis’ eight fight-night bonuses for UFC heavyweight bouts are tied with Stefan Struve for second-most in divisional historical past behind Stipe Miocic (9).

Joaquin Buckley vs. Nursulton Ruziboev

Joaquin Buckley

Joaquin Buckley

Joaquin Buckley (19-6 MMA, 8-4 UFC) is 3-0 since he dropped to the welterweight division in Might 2023.

Buckley is one in all 5 fighters in UFC historical past to earn a knockout stemming from a spinning again kick to the top, which he did at UFC on ESPN+ 37. Renan Barao, Uriah Corridor, Natalia Silva and Magomed Mustafaev additionally completed the feat.

Alonzo Menifield vs. Carlos Ulberg

Alonzo Menifield

Alonzo Menifield

Alonzo Menifield (15-3-1 MMA, 8-3-1 UFC) has earned 13 of his 15 profession victories by stoppage. That features six of his eight UFC wins.

Carlos Ulberg

Carlos Ulberg

Carlos Ulberg’s (8-1 MMA, 5-1 UFC) five-fight UFC profitable streak at mild heavyweight is tied with Khalil Rountree for the longest lively streak within the division.

Ulberg’s four-fight UFC stoppage streak is tied for the third-longest amongst lively fighters within the firm behind Shavkat Rakhmonov (six) and Joanderson Brito (5).

Ulberg lands 60.3 p.c of his important strike makes an attempt in UFC mild heavyweight competitors, the very best fee in divisional historical past.

Ulberg lands 7.4 important strikes per minute in UFC mild heavyweight competitors, the very best fee in divisional historical past.

Terrance McKinney vs. Esteban Ribovics

Terrance McKinney

Terrance McKinney (15-6 MMA, 5-3 UFC) has earned all 15 of his profession victories by stoppage. He’s completed all 5 of his UFC wins within the first spherical.

McKinney’s common struggle time of two:53 in UFC light-weight competitors is the shortest in divisional historical past.

McKinney’s seven-second knockout at UFC 263 is tied for the fourth quickest in UFC historical past. Jorge Masvidal holds the document with a five-second end.

McKinney’s seven-second knockout at UFC 263 is the quickest in UFC historical past by a debuting fighter.

McKinney’s seven-second knockout at UFC 263 is the quickest in UFC light-weight historical past.

McKinney is one in all three fighters in UFC historical past to earn a number of knockout victories of 20 seconds or much less. Anthony Johnson and Matthew Semelsberger additionally completed the feat.
